Q: Is 23,101,204 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 23,101,204 is a composite number.

Why is 23,101,204 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 23,101,204 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 14 28 41 82 164 287 574 1,148 20,123 40,246 80,492 140,861 281,722 563,444 825,043 1,650,086 3,300,172 5,775,301 11,550,602 and 23,101,204, with no remainder.

Since 23,101,204 cannot be divided by just 1 and 23,101,204, it is a composite number.
